Trump says he will declare a national emergency as we are recording today’s podcast.
Despite earlier warnings to the contrary, Mitch McConnell now seems to be on board with Trump in support of declaring a national emergency. Meanwhile, McConnell is going to force a vote on “Green New Deal” resolution introduced by AOC and Senator Markey. The Turtle thinks he’s playing political hardball, but we think it’s going to blow up in his face.
Beto O’Rourke meets with Schumer to discuss 2020 Senate run. Denver teachers go on strike for the first time in 25 years. After three days they come away with a win. Amazon got its foo foos hurt by community protests and kills HQ2 plans for New York. You get a second chance, Gov. Wolf.
New GOP proposal calls for employers to take student loan payments directly out of employees paychecks. Atmospheric river dumps record rain on California. Fear of mudslides and flooding, given the summer of fire.
Lt. Governor John Fetterman’s marijuana legalization tour starts rolling through central Pennsylvania. Hundreds of supporters showed up at the Dauphin and Cumberland Counties stops. House Democratic Labor and Industry Chair Pat Harkins is back on board with Governor Wolf’s minimum wage plan.
Post Gazette editor John Block went on an epically drunken rant in the Gazette’s news Saturday. Block had his young daughter with him as he demanded to get a photo in front of a poster that read “Shame on the Blocks.”
PASSHE Chancellor Daniel Greenstein testifies at PA budget hearings. He seemed to give a shot across the bow to the faculty union, saying that unless the relationship changes and becomes more collaborative, saving PASSHE is a fool’s errand.
